Bubble mailers consist of a strong puncture resistant mail bag with bubbles filled with air. Due to their specifics, bubble mailers are a very effective shipping material, protecting your products against the hazards of shipping. Bubble mailers are extremely cost effective, because they are lightweight and require less postage than shipping boxes. There are also self-sealing bubble mailers that save valuable insertion and fastening time and offer added tampering security.

Bubble mailers are used to ship variety of things. Mostly, bubble mailers are used for the packaging of CD's, DVD's, cell phones, video games, cosmetics, jewelry, trading cards, hardware & tools, accessories. It should be pointed out that despite the fact that bubble mailers have excellent cushioning capabilities, they don't have any stacking strength. That's why, they are not recomended for shipping goods that can be easily crushed.

Bubble mailers are based on the Bubble Wrap technology patented by Sealed Air. Bubble wrap is a pliable transparent plastic with regularly spaced air-filled hemispheres (bubbles), which provide cushioning for precious or breakable items. The bubble wrap technology was invented by Alfred Fielding and Marc Chavannes, in 1957. As it with most innovations, this one also happened accidentally, when the two engineers were trying to create a textured plastic wallpaper.

When Alfred Fielding and Marc Chavannes realized the potential of their discovery, they went on to patent the technology and created the Sealed Air Corporation 1960. 47 years later, Sealed Air is still the leading company in its industry constantly innovating and providing consumers with improved materials. The bubble mailers from Sealed Air have higher initial thickness and fullness, and provide up to 30% greater protection. This is possible thanks to the new barrier layer introduced by Sealed Air, which is 100 times more resistant to the passage of air than even a thick single layer of polyethylene used by other brands.

Compared to other materials, bubble mailers have several main advantages. To start with, you get better value, because less packaging material is used. They are also reusable and recyclable which is a huge environmental benefit.
